当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

服务器负载均衡配置,深入解析服务器负载均衡配置,原理、策略与实战案例

服务器负载均衡配置,深入解析服务器负载均衡配置,原理、策略与实战案例

深入解析服务器负载均衡配置,涵盖原理、策略及实战案例。本文旨在帮助读者全面了解负载均衡配置,从基本概念到具体应用,提升服务器性能和稳定性。...

深入解析服务器负载均衡配置,涵盖原理、策略及实战案例。本文旨在帮助读者全面了解负载均衡配置,从基本概念到具体应用,提升服务器性能和稳定性。

随着互联网技术的飞速发展,企业对服务器性能和稳定性的要求越来越高,服务器负载均衡作为一项关键技术,在提高服务器性能、保障系统稳定运行方面发挥着至关重要的作用,本文将深入解析服务器负载均衡配置,包括其原理、策略以及实战案例,旨在帮助读者全面了解并掌握这一技术。

服务器负载均衡配置,深入解析服务器负载均衡配置,原理、策略与实战案例

服务器负载均衡原理

1、负载均衡的定义

负载均衡是指将用户请求分配到多个服务器上,实现负载均衡的一种技术,通过负载均衡,可以充分利用服务器资源,提高系统性能,降低单台服务器的压力,从而保障系统稳定运行。

2、负载均衡的原理

负载均衡的原理主要包括以下几个方面:

(1)流量分发:负载均衡器将用户请求分发到不同的服务器上,实现流量均衡。

(2)健康检查:负载均衡器定期对服务器进行健康检查,确保只有健康的服务器才能接收请求。

(3)策略选择:负载均衡器根据一定的策略选择合适的服务器处理请求,如轮询、最少连接数、IP哈希等。

(4)会话保持:负载均衡器可以将用户的会话信息保存在服务器上,保证用户在会话期间始终访问同一台服务器。

服务器负载均衡策略

1、轮询(Round Robin)

轮询是最常见的负载均衡策略,将请求按照顺序分配给每台服务器,直到所有服务器都处理过请求,然后重新开始。

2、最少连接数(Least Connections)

服务器负载均衡配置,深入解析服务器负载均衡配置,原理、策略与实战案例

最少连接数策略将请求分配给连接数最少的服务器,这样可以保证新请求不会一直被分配到连接数较多的服务器上。

3、IP哈希(IP Hash)

IP哈希策略根据用户IP地址将请求分配到不同的服务器,确保同一IP地址的用户始终访问同一台服务器。

4、加权轮询(Weighted Round Robin)

加权轮询策略在轮询的基础上,为每台服务器分配一个权重,根据权重值分配请求,权重越高,分配到的请求越多。

5、加权最少连接数(Weighted Least Connections)

加权最少连接数策略在最少连接数的基础上,为每台服务器分配一个权重,根据权重值分配请求。

实战案例

1、案例背景

某企业搭建了一个电商平台,需要处理大量用户请求,为提高系统性能和稳定性,企业决定采用负载均衡技术。

2、解决方案

(1)选择负载均衡器:根据企业需求,选择高性能、易管理的负载均衡器,如Nginx、LVS等。

服务器负载均衡配置,深入解析服务器负载均衡配置,原理、策略与实战案例

(2)配置负载均衡策略:根据业务特点,选择合适的负载均衡策略,如轮询、最少连接数等。

(3)健康检查:配置负载均衡器的健康检查功能,确保只有健康的服务器才能接收请求。

(4)会话保持:为关键业务配置会话保持功能,保证用户在会话期间始终访问同一台服务器。

3、实施步骤

(1)搭建负载均衡环境:安装并配置负载均衡器,如Nginx。

(2)配置服务器:将服务器加入负载均衡集群,并配置相关参数。

(3)测试验证:测试负载均衡效果,确保系统性能和稳定性。

服务器负载均衡技术在提高系统性能、保障系统稳定运行方面具有重要意义,本文深入解析了服务器负载均衡配置,包括原理、策略以及实战案例,旨在帮助读者全面了解并掌握这一技术,在实际应用中,应根据业务需求选择合适的负载均衡策略,并配置相关参数,以实现最佳性能。

黑狐家游戏

发表评论

最新文章